Top DevOps Interview Questions And Answers in 2025

Top DevOps Interview Questions And Answers in 2025

DevOps has gotten to be one of the most sought-after disciplines in the IT industry, and as businesses move towards embracing DevOps hones, the request for DevOps experts proceeds to rise. In any case, the DevOps meet prepare can be a challenging encounter, particularly for candidates who are modern to the field. If you’re planning for a DevOps meet in 2025, you require to be well-versed with the key concepts, apparatuses, and hones that are likely to be discussed.

In this article, we will cover best DevOps meet questions and answers in 2025. These questions are outlined to test your information of both the specialized angles of DevOps and your understanding of how it fits into the bigger setting of program advancement, arrangement, and operations.

1. What is DevOps?

The to begin with address you’re likely to experience in a DevOps meet is a essential one: What is DevOps?

DevOps is a program advancement technique that coordinating advancement (Dev) and operations (Ops) groups. The objective of DevOps is to improve collaboration between these groups, increment the speed of program conveyance, and make strides the quality of the computer program. DevOps empowers mechanization, ceaseless integration and nonstop conveyance (CI/CD), and reliable input circles all through the advancement lifecycle.

Key Points:

DevOps centers on collaboration, computerization, and persistent feedback.

It points to abbreviate improvement cycles and progress computer program quality.

CI/CD is a center guideline of DevOps.

2. What are the benefits of DevOps?

One of the most critical questions that managers inquire to gage your understanding of the esteem of DevOps is: What are the benefits of DevOps?

DevOps offers various benefits for associations that actualize it correctly:

Faster Program Conveyance: By computerizing manual forms and utilizing CI/CD pipelines, groups can convey computer program speedier and more reliably.

Improved Collaboration: DevOps bridges the crevice between advancement and operations groups, empowering way better communication and collaboration.

Increased Productivity: Robotization diminishes dreary errands, empowering groups to center on high-value work.

Better Quality: Ceaseless testing and criticism circles offer assistance to capture issues prior, driving to higher-quality software.

Scalability: DevOps apparatuses and hones permit associations to scale their framework rapidly and efficiently.

3. What are a few prevalent DevOps tools?

DevOps depends intensely on apparatuses to computerize forms and encourage communication between groups. When inquired almost apparatuses, be arranged to talk about well known DevOps devices and their capacities. Here are a few key ones:

Jenkins: A prevalent instrument for robotizing construct and sending processes.

Docker: A containerization apparatus that empowers applications to run in disconnected environments.

Kubernetes: A holder organization stage for mechanizing the sending, scaling, and administration of containerized applications.

Git: A adaptation control framework that permits groups to track changes in code.

Terraform: An Foundation as Code (IaC) instrument that permits groups to characterize and arrangement framework through code.

Key Points:

Tools like Jenkins and Docker offer assistance computerize advancement and arrangement processes.

Kubernetes streamlines holder management.

Git and Terraform encourage form control and foundation management.

4. Clarify the concept of Nonstop Integration (CI) and Ceaseless Conveyance (CD).

Another common address in DevOps interviews is: What is the distinction between Nonstop Integration (CI) and Persistent Conveyance (CD)?

Continuous Integration (CI) alludes to the hone of regularly combining all designer changes into a central store, taken after by computerized builds and tests. The objective is to identify bugs early and dodge integration issues.

Continuous Conveyance (CD) takes CI a step encourage by computerizing the arrangement prepare. With CD, computer program is continuously in a deployable state, and unused highlights are naturally pushed to generation as before long as they pass testing.

Key Points:

CI centers on joining code changes frequently.

CD robotizes the sending handle, guaranteeing code is continuously prepared for production.

5. What is Foundation as Code (IaC)?

Infrastructure as Code (IaC) is a DevOps hone where framework is overseen utilizing code and computerization instep of manual forms. With IaC, engineers can characterize and oversee foundation through arrangement records that are version-controlled.

This approach brings numerous benefits, including:

Consistency: IaC disposes of human blunders by guaranteeing framework is conveyed the same way each time.

Scalability: Foundation can be effectively scaled by adjusting the code and redeploying it.

Version Control: Like application code, foundation code is version-controlled, permitting groups to track changes and roll back if needed.

Key Points:

IaC permits you to oversee framework through code.

Terraform and AWS CloudFormation are well known IaC tools.

6. What is containerization, and how does it relate to DevOps?

DevOps experts regularly work with holders, and questioners need to know if you get it the concept of containerization.

Containerization includes bundling an application and its conditions into a holder. This holder can at that point be run reliably over distinctive situations, from advancement to testing and generation. The most well known containerization instrument is Docker.

Key Points:

Containers give consistency over environments.

Docker is the driving containerization apparatus utilized in DevOps.

Containers are lightweight and proficient, empowering speedier deployment.

7. What is Kubernetes?

When examining containerization, the subject of Kubernetes is likely to come up. Kubernetes is an open-source holder organization device that makes a difference oversee, scale, and convey containerized applications. Kubernetes is basic for taking care of large-scale applications running in containers.

Key Points:

Kubernetes robotizes the sending, scaling, and administration of containerized applications.

It works with apparatuses like Docker to give a effective holder administration system.

8. What are microservices, and how do they relate to DevOps?

Microservices allude to an building fashion where an application is created as a collection of freely coupled administrations. Each benefit is free, permitting it to be sent, overhauled, and scaled individually.

DevOps and microservices are closely related since both point to increment deftness and adaptability in computer program improvement. DevOps hones, such as CI/CD, are perfect for overseeing microservices since they advance visit overhauls and automation.

Key Points:

Microservices break down expansive applications into littler, autonomously deployable components.

DevOps hones bolster the productive administration and arrangement of microservices.

9. How do you guarantee security in a DevOps environment?

Security is a basic concern in any IT environment, and DevOps is no special case. DevSecOps is the hone of joining security into the DevOps pipeline. It guarantees that security is considered from the starting of the improvement handle and not as an afterthought.

Some best hones for guaranteeing security in DevOps include:

Automating security tests as portion of the CI/CD pipeline.

Using instruments like SonarQube to recognize vulnerabilities in code.

Enforcing secure coding hones and normal security audits.

Key Points:

DevSecOps coordinating security into the DevOps lifecycle.

Automated security testing and reviews offer assistance keep up a secure environment.

10. What are a few challenges in actualizing DevOps?

While DevOps offers various benefits, it’s not without challenges. Common challenges in actualizing DevOps include:

Cultural Resistance: Groups may be safe to alter and hesitant to receive unused practices.

Lack of Aptitudes: DevOps requires particular specialized abilities, and finding qualified experts can be difficult.

Tooling Over-burden: With so numerous DevOps apparatuses accessible, choosing the right devices for the work can be overwhelming.

Key Points:

Overcoming social resistance is a key challenge when executing DevOps.

DevOps experts must have a wide extend of specialized skills.

Conclusion

Preparing for a DevOps meet in 2025 requires more than fair specialized knowledge—it moreover includes understanding the standards behind DevOps hones and how they contribute to the victory of present day program advancement groups. By acing these best meet questions and answers, you’ll be superior prepared to inspire contracting supervisors and arrive your another DevOps role.

Whether it’s mechanizing forms with CI/CD, conveying containerized applications utilizing Kubernetes, or guaranteeing security through DevSecOps, DevOps has ended up an vital portion of the cutting edge improvement lifecycle. By displaying your mastery in these regions, you’ll illustrate your esteem as a candidate prepared to flourish in a DevOps-driven association.

Contact us & Enroll and Get certified, grow your skills, and unlock global opportunities!

First Name
Last Name
Email
Phone
Message
The form has been submitted successfully!
There has been some error while submitting the form. Please verify all form fields again.

Leave a Comment

Your email address will not be published. Required fields are marked *